Liza Weil is an American actress recognized for her roles in popular television series such as “Gilmore Girls” and “How to Get Away with Murder,” bringing depth and complexity to each character she portrays. After making her feature film debut in Whatever (1998), which premiered at the esteemed Sundance Film Festival, and following with a role in Stir of Echoes (1999) alongside Kevin Bacon, Liza Weil signed a talent holding deal with Warner Bros. This led to notable guest appearances in critically acclaimed television series including ER and The West Wing. Her professional trajectory gained significant momentum with her breakthrough role as the iconic and fan-favorite character Paris Geller in the WB/CW comedy-drama series Gilmore Girls (20002007), a character specifically created for her after an initial audition, solidifying her presence in a long-running cultural phenomenon.
